'IndiaCast' is a multi-platform 'Content Asset Monetization' entity. IndiaCast drives Domestic and International Channel Distribution, Placement Services and Content Syndication for TV18, Viacom18, A+E Networks, TV18 and the ETV channels. Distributing 26 channels from these media houses across platforms including Cable, DTH, IPTV, HITS and MMDS, it offers a range of channels from entertainment, kids, news, infotainment and music, to regional genres.
